The Key Technology For Turbocharger Nozzle Ring Leaves’ Special Manufacture Equipment Research

In recent years, automobile industry in our country has developed vigorously, it has become a new mainstay of our national economy. Our country has replaced the United States as first automobile production and marketing kingdom of the world in2010,has become the emerging automobile superpower. With a increase number of people owner car, its brings serious environment pollution problem, some countries have set the standards of the emissions, as well as our country puts forward our own’s car emissions standards.The invention of turbocharge technology not only reduce oil consumption but also improve the engine’s power, reduce the harmful gas composition of automobile exhaust.So many countries especially the developed countries has invested a lot of manpower in the turbocharged technology r&d and manufacturing.Variable spout turbocharger technology is a new technology, it will be widely used in the future.The blade is the most critical parts of the turbocharger, this technology is just appeared, so there is no special processing equipment for it’s manufacture. The processing of blade is precision casting and precision forging is blank, then mechanical processing and light finishing.General, domestic use the grinding wheel to manually polish, it’s low production efficiency and high scrap rate.This topic according to turbocharger nozzle ring blades’characteristics and processing requirement, we have made the nozzle ring blade centerless grinding process analysis and research,based on centerless grinding movement analysis, we get the grinder mechanical structure analysis, confirmed machine structure configuration form and completed the grinder mechanical structure design; trial-manufacture and debug the grinder machine tool of variable geometry turbochargers nozzle leaf.The centerless grinding experiments of nozzle ring blade is to verify the centerless grinding technology application in turbocharger nozzle ring blade precision processing, and achieved the expect effect,accumulated experience for the subsequent product development, it’s fill in the blank of use centerless grinding technology processing turbocharger nozzle ring of blades in our country, and promote level of technology in turbocharger nozzle ring blade manufacture.
